On Friday, October 4th, the 32nd LIEBHERR European Table Tennis Championships starts with the Team Event. The Organisers are well prepared to welcome fans, players, officials and spectators from all over Europe. The Austria’s sporting goals are to win two medals.

Vienna will gathers more than 1.000 accredited persons, including players, officials, umpires and referees and the Organising Committee itself. 25.000 spectators are expected for the LIEBHERR 2013 European Table Tennis Championships from 4th to 13th October in Schwechat/Austria.

Rudolf SPORRER, General Secretary of the Austrian Table Tennis Association said : “At the moment we are preparing the Event hall of the Multiversum Schwechat and the Werner SCHLAGER Academy for the event. Everything is running well and we are looking forward to welcome the first nations, arriving on Wednesday.“

The teams and players will play on twelve tables at the same time, 67 referees and umpires guarantee fair games, fans and guests from all over Europe are expected, more than 140 media representatives will report from the Championships, 50 Volunteers are helping the Organising Committee and in ten days more than 1.100 games will be played!
